I've got a DEC 3000/300 box that netboots off another alpha.

PHK's recent change to bootp_subr broke netbooting for me:

----------------------------
revision 1.21
date: 2000/05/07 14:29:19;  author: phk;  state: Exp;  lines: +18 -6
Include a RFC 1533 "Maximum DHCP Message Size" option in our request.

ISC DHCP will limit the reply length to 64 bytes for bootp replies
unless we explicitly tell it we can do more.  We tell it that we can do
1200 bytes.
----------------------------

I've got the following entry in /etc/bootptab:

modena.plutotech.com: \
        :ht=ethernet:ha=08002bbb4eb3: \
        :ip=206.168.67.197:sm=255.255.255.128: \
        :sa=206.168.67.172:bf=netboot:rp="206.168.67.172:/b/modena/": \
        :vm=rfc10248:

And the following in /etc/inetd.conf:

tftp    dgram   udp     wait    root    /usr/libexec/tftpd      tftpd -l -s /b/modena /
bootps  dgram   udp     wait    root    /usr/libexec/bootpd     bootpd

The relevant kernel config options are:

options         BOOTP           # Use BOOTP to obtain IP address/hostname
options         BOOTP_NFSROOT   # NFS mount root filesystem using BOOTP info
options         BOOTP_NFSV3     # Use NFS v3 to NFS mount root
options         BOOTP_COMPAT    # Workaround for broken bootp daemons.
options         BOOTP_WIRED_TO=le0 # Use interface fxp0 for BOOTP
options         NFS_ROOT                #NFS usable as root device

I get these messages in /var/log/messages on the bootp server:


May 22 15:40:49 subway bootpd[9630]: modena.plutotech.com: No room for "rp" option
May 22 15:40:49 subway bootpd[9630]: modena.plutotech.com: No room for "(end)" option
May 22 15:40:49 subway bootpd[9630]: sendto: Invalid argument
May 22 15:40:50 subway bootpd[9630]: modena.plutotech.com: No room for "rp" option
May 22 15:40:50 subway bootpd[9630]: modena.plutotech.com: No room for "(end)" option
May 22 15:40:50 subway bootpd[9630]: sendto: Invalid argument
May 22 15:40:52 subway bootpd[9630]: modena.plutotech.com: No room for "rp" option
May 22 15:40:52 subway bootpd[9630]: modena.plutotech.com: No room for "(end)" option
May 22 15:40:52 subway bootpd[9630]: sendto: Invalid argument

And the following repeats on the console of the machine that is trying to
netboot:

BOOTP timeout for server 0xffffffff

tcpdump reports the following bootp packets:

15:42:05.547967 0.0.0.0.68 > 255.255.255.255.67:  xid:0xffffff01 secs:75 flags:0x8000 file ""[|bootp]
15:42:10.597649 0.0.0.0.68 > 255.255.255.255.67:  xid:0xffffff01 secs:80 flags:0x8000 file ""[|bootp]
15:42:15.647403 0.0.0.0.68 > 255.255.255.255.67:  xid:0xffffff01 secs:85 flags:0x8000 file ""[|bootp]

Backing bootp_subr.c to rev 1.20 (the one before PHK's change) fixes
netbooting for me.

Should I change something in my configuration to get it to work again, or
is there something wrong with the change?
